What is the different between shortage and surplus?

A shortage is when there is a LACK (not enough) of that particular resource/product/item. A surplus is when there is EXCESS, or too much of a resource/product/item.

What is instances of a resource in Resource Allocation Graph?

an instance of a resource is the no. of resources of a particular resource type are available. For eg: If we say we have 5 instances of a resource printer,it simply means that there are five printers available for use.
